diff --git a/ChangeLog b/ChangeLog index 6963994..08042c5 100644 --- a/ChangeLog +++ b/ChangeLog @@ -1,3 +1,14 @@ +2013-05-19 Paul Eggert <egg...@cs.ucla.edu> + + malloca: port to compilers that reject size-zero arrays + This fixes a bug introduced in my previous patch. + * lib/malloca.c (struct preliminary_header): Use an int + rather than a character array of size int; that's simpler. + (struct header): Remove, replacing with ... + (union header): New type. This avoids the need for declaring a + character array of size zero, which is not allowed on some platforms. + All uses changed. + 2013-05-18 Paul Eggert <egg...@cs.ucla.edu> parse-datetime, tests: don't use "string" + int diff --git a/lib/malloca.c b/lib/malloca.c index 53ecb81..7a4b0cd 100644 --- a/lib/malloca.c +++ b/lib/malloca.c @@ -49,12 +49,18 @@ #define MAGIC_SIZE sizeof (int) /* This is how the header info would look like without any alignment considerations. */ -struct preliminary_header { void *next; char room[MAGIC_SIZE]; }; +struct preliminary_header { void *next; int magic; }; /* But the header's size must be a multiple of sa_alignment_max. */ #define HEADER_SIZE \ (((sizeof (struct preliminary_header) + sa_alignment_max - 1) / sa_alignment_max) * sa_alignment_max) -struct header { void *next; char room[HEADER_SIZE - sizeof (struct preliminary_header)]; int magic; }; -verify (HEADER_SIZE == sizeof (struct header)); +union header { + void *next; + struct { + char room[HEADER_SIZE - MAGIC_SIZE]; + int word; + } magic; +}; +verify (HEADER_SIZE == sizeof (union header)); /* We make the hash table quite big, so that during lookups the probability of empty hash buckets is quite high.
